The "Laal Lihaaf" (Red Quilt) series follows the story of Kusum, a woman trapped in a mundane and emotionally unfulfilling marriage. The narrative explores how her loneliness leads her down a path of unexpected companionship and secret affairs. Laal Lihaaf Part 2 -2021- ULLU Original

The reception to Laal Lihaaf has been mixed, but it has certainly made an impact. On the positive side, Sneha Paul's performance as Kusum has been praised for convincingly portraying the character's inner struggle and emotional vulnerability. The series is also recognized for being bold and daring, venturing into emotional and thematic territory that mainstream content often avoids. Furthermore, it has been commended for its thought-provoking nature, encouraging audiences to think about dysfunctional relationships, suppressed needs, and the search for identity.
